Transaction d99c220bdbecd31eb503a318acf796bbba124ba59e565c7444db2d62c41ec70a

2 Input
2 Outputs
  • d99c220bdbecd31eb503a318acf796bbba124ba59e565c7444db2d62c41ec70a:0
  • value  5666038
    address  1Fc3upLBRssbB4rvkjycJb8UX327mFY2RY
  • d99c220bdbecd31eb503a318acf796bbba124ba59e565c7444db2d62c41ec70a:1
  • value  6299117
    address  15RmXtADF4E6jdUevDhRNkBVSy6fA1iySz